FAJITA SEASONING
This is a great recipe to make your own fajita seasoning. No bouillon cubes means this is perfect for vegetarians too! Make up a larger batch and store in an airtight container for future use.
Provided by Traci Meeds
Categories World Cuisine Recipes Latin American Mexican
Time 5m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Stir cornstarch, chili powder, salt, paprika, sugar, onion powder, garlic powder, cayenne pepper, and cumin together in a small bowl.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 20.9 calories, Carbohydrate 4.6 g, Fat 0.4 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 0.4 g, SaturatedFat 0.1 g, Sodium 595.8 mg, Sugar 1.4 g

FAJITA SEASONING
Make your own spice mix using storecupboard staples. Use in fajitas instead of a ready-made spice mix, or rub onto meats and vegetables for an extra dose of flavour in other meals
Provided by Esther Clark
Categories Condiment
Time 5m
Yield Makes 1 small jar
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Put all the ingredients in a bowl and mix to combine. Tip into a small jar or container and store in a dark, cool place. Use as you wish, adding 1 tsp at a time to a dish according to taste.
